The FSQA Technician II is a mid-level role responsible for executing food safety and quality assurance protocols across production shifts. This position supports the FSQA team by conducting inspections, monitoring compliance with regulatory and internal standards, and mentoring FSQA Tech I team members. Technician II plays a key role in maintaining product integrity and ensuring a safe, high-quality food production environment.

\n


Duties/Responsibilities:
  • Conduct inspections of raw materials, in-process items, and finished goods for compliance with food safety and quality standards. 
  • Perform environmental monitoring, allergen testing, sanitation verification, and metal detection checks. 
  • Document findings and escalate deviations or non-conformances to FSQA leadership. 
  • Assist in pre-operational inspections and verify corrective actions. 
  • Support internal and third-party audits by preparing documentation and participating in walkthroughs. 
  • Train and mentor FSQA Tech I team members on SOPs, GMPs, and food safety protocols. 
  • Collaborate with production, sanitation, and maintenance teams to resolve quality issues. 
  • Maintain accurate records in compliance with SQF, HACCP, and internal traceability systems. 
  • Participate in BOS (Behavior Observation Surveys), Risk Prediction assessments, and 5S audits. 


Required Skills/Abilities:
  • Working knowledge of food safety regulations and quality assurance principles. 
  • Familiarity with HACCP, GMP, USDA, FDA, and SQF standards. 
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to follow procedures precisely. 
  • Effective communication and documentation skills. 
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team. 
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and quality management systems. 


Education and Experience:
  • High school diploma or equivalent required; associate degree or coursework in food science or related field preferred. 
  • 1–3 years of experience in food manufacturing or quality assurance. 
  • Prior experience in a regulated food production environment is strongly preferred.
